What is a Pellet Stove Insert?
A pellet stove insert is a heating gadget that is developed to be installed in an existing fireplace. It burns wood pellets, which are made from compressed sawdust and other wood byproducts. The combustion process is extremely efficient, producing minimal emissions while providing consistent heat.

The installation of a pellet stove insert includes numerous actions and must be performed by a qualified technician. Here's a streamlined breakdown of the installation process:
Step-by-Step Installation
Inspection: Before installation, an expert must examine your fireplace to ensure it can accommodate a pellet insert.

Picking the Right Insert: Choose an insert that fits your fireplace dimensions and meets your heating needs.

Chimney Preparation: Ensure that your chimney is clean and in excellent condition. A liner may be needed for safety and effectiveness.

Ventilation: Proper ventilation is vital. Many White Pellet Stoves inserts require a venting system that directs smoke outside.

Placing the Insert: Place the pellet stove insert in the fireplace according to producer specs.

Connecting to Power: Most pellet stoves need electrical power for the fan and feed system, so plug it into a close-by outlet.

Final Check: Once set up, the technician ought to perform a safety check and show the operation of the insert.
Table: Typical Installation CostsSetup ElementApproximated Cost (GBP)Inspecting Fireplace₤ 100 - ₤ 300Pellet Stove Insert₤ 1,500 - ₤ 4,000Venting System₤ 200 - ₤ 1,000Labor Costs₤ 200 - ₤ 500Total Estimated Cost₤ 2,000 - ₤ 6,800
(Note: Prices may differ based upon place and specific requirements)
Maintenance Tips
To keep your pellet stove insert operating effectively, regular maintenance is necessary. Here's a list of vital maintenance jobs:

Clean the Insert: Clean the burn pot and ash pan frequently to avoid obstructions and make sure ideal burn efficiency.

Examine the Venting System: Inspect the venting system for any blockages or damage at least as soon as a year.

Inspect the Exhaust Blower: Ensure that the exhaust blower is operating properly and devoid of debris.

Change Gaskets: Over time, the gaskets around the door and clean-out door can break. Replace them to keep a tight seal.

Yearly Professional Service: Schedule a yearly maintenance visit with a qualified service technician to guarantee everything is functioning securely and effectively.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Just how much does it cost to run a pellet stove insert?
The cost of running a Pellet Stoves With Blower stove insert depends on a number of aspects, including local pellet prices and heating requirements. On average, house owners may spend around ₤ 150 to ₤ 300 per heating season on pellets.
2. Can I utilize regular wood in a pellet stove insert?
No, pellet stoves are particularly designed to burn wood pellets. Burning routine Wood Pellet Stoves can damage the insert and create hazardous conditions.
3. How often do I need to clean my pellet stove insert?
It is suggested to clean up the insert a minimum of when a week throughout peak use. In addition, carry out a comprehensive cleansing and examination at the end of the heating season.
4. What type of pellets should I utilize?
It is best to use high-quality pellets that are identified as premium. These pellets are made with fewer impurities and burn more efficiently.
5. Can a pellet stove insert be installed in any fireplace?
Not all fireplaces appropriate for Purchase Pellet Stoves stove inserts. A competent professional should inspect your fireplace to determine compatibility.
6. For how long do pellet stove inserts last?
With proper maintenance, a pellet stove insert can last 15 to 20 years, making it a long-term investment for home heating.
